Betty's Blues (2013)
Synopsis
The story begins in the basement of a worn-out blues bar in Louisiana in the 1980s. A few regular customers are having a drink. A guitarist gets on stage and everybody comments on the newcomer. The guitarist draws the attention of the audience by tapping the microphone. He introduces himself. He will tell them the true story of Blind Boogie Jones.
Release Date: 2013-02-08
Runtime: 12 minutes
Director: Rémi Vandenitte
